Description

Remote GHCi message types and serialization.

For details on Remote GHCi, see Note [Remote GHCi] in compilerghciGHCi.hs.

data Message a where Source

A Message a is a message that returns a value of type a. These are requests sent from GHC to the server.

Constructors

Shutdown :: Message ()

Exit the iserv process

CreateBCOs :: [ByteString] -> Message [HValueRef]

Create a set of BCO objects, and return HValueRefs to them Note: Each ByteString contains a Binary-encoded [ResolvedBCO], not a ResolvedBCO. The list is to allow us to serialise the ResolvedBCOs in parallel. See createBCOs in compilerghciGHCi.hsc.

FreeHValueRefs :: [HValueRef] -> Message ()

Release HValueRefs

StartTH :: Message (RemoteRef (IORef QState))

Start a new TH module, return a state token that should be

RunTH :: RemoteRef (IORef QState) -> HValueRef -> THResultType -> Maybe Loc -> Message (QResult ByteString)

Evaluate a TH computation.

Returns a ByteString, because we have to force the result before returning it to ensure there are no errors lurking in it. The TH types don't have NFData instances, and even if they did, we have to serialize the value anyway, so we might as well serialize it to force it.

RunModFinalizers :: RemoteRef (IORef QState) -> [RemoteRef (Q ())] -> Message (QResult ())

Run the given mod finalizers.

GetClosure :: HValueRef -> Message (GenClosure HValueRef)

Remote interface to GHC.Exts.Heap.getClosureData. This is used by the GHCi debugger to inspect values in the heap for :print and type reconstruction.

Seq :: HValueRef -> Message (EvalResult ())

Evaluate something. This is used to support :force in GHCi.

data QResult a Source

Template Haskell return values

Constructors

QDone a

RunTH finished successfully; return value follows

QException String

RunTH threw an exception

QFail String

RunTH called fail

data EvalExpr a Source

We can pass simple expressions to EvalStmt, consisting of values and application. This allows us to wrap the statement to be executed in another function, which is used by GHCi to implement :set args and :set prog. It might be worthwhile to extend this little language in the future.

Constructors

EvalThis a
EvalApp (EvalExpr a) (EvalExpr a)

data QState Source

The server-side Template Haskell state. This is created by the StartTH message. A new one is created per module that GHC typechecks.
